Meg Tirrell Career Tirrell joined CNBC in March 2014 to serve as a general assignment reporter focusing on biotechnology and pharmaceuticals. Furthermore, she appears on CNBC’s Business Day programming, contributes to CNBC.com. Tirrell has covered the advancement of new treatments for Alzheimer’s, cancer, and rare disorders …

Meg Tirrell began her career as a senior health and science reporter for CNBC before moving on to her current role as a medical correspondent for CNN's Health unit. Her journalistic journey has seen her cover a range of medical topics, from the development of new medicines for Alzheimer's disease, cancer, and rare diseases to public health ...
